Role Overview
The primary responsibility for this position is the preparation and timely filing of federal and state individual and fiduciary income tax returns, charitable returns, and tax estimates of the highest complexity, including the gathering and analysis of all information needed to complete these returns and to determine the lowest lawful tax burden for the client.
The incumbent also prepares and timely files other related tax returns, tax estimates and tax information documents, and performs calculations of the highest complexity of various tax scenarios to assist and work with both clients and the lawyers with strategic ta x planning.
Responsibilities
- Prepares and timely files federal and state individual and fiduciary income tax returns of the highest complexity as assigned by the Manager of Tax Services ("Manager"), including quarterly federal and state tax estimates as required.
- Prepares and timely files required tax returns and estimates or withholding as applicable for non-profit organizations, non-resident alien trust beneficiaries and other return preparation assignments as determined by the Manager.
- Prepares and timely files federal gift tax returns and performs gift tax planning projections as requested by the lawyers and as assigned by the Manager.
- Performs federal and state income tax projections and planning to assist the lawyers in strategic tax planning for clients as assigned by the Manager.
- Analyzes trusts and other documents to determine the tax return requirements for related accounts as assigned by the Manager.
- Reviews tax returns and other work product prepared by other tax accountants as assigned by the Manage r and reports to the Manager regarding the accuracy of the work product reviewed.
- Prepares for review by the Manager or designee, amended returns, claims for refunds and applications for abatement as needed to determine the proper tax liability for accounts assigned to the incumbent. Reviews said documents when prepared by other income tax accountants, as assigned by the Manager.
- Conducts and participates in audits of a client’s tax return(s) with federal and state tax authorities of any tax returns prepared by the incumbent, or an income tax accountant. Keeps Manager and all parties apprised of the process and consults with Manager and lawyers as appropriate.
- Serves as mentor to income tax accountants and provides consultative and interpretative support to other tax accountants within Tax Services on tax and technical support matters.
- Confers with and assists the Manager and Director in formulating and drafting appropriate policies and procedures.
- Executes other duties assigned by the Manager which are consistent with the objective of delivering timely and accurate tax administration services to our clients.

Compensation
The anticipated base salary range for this position is $100,000 - $130,000. Final base compensation will be carefully determined based on several factors including relevant knowledge, skillset, and experience. Additionally, this role may be eligible for other forms of compensation and benefits, such as discretionary bonus, health, dental, and vision plans, and employer 401(k) contributions.
